一、验证码位数演进与6位验证码的行业选择
从早期4位验证码到当前主流的6位验证码,位数设计始终在安全性与易用性之间寻求平衡。6位验证码的数学组合达到百万级可能性(10^6),相比4位验证码的万级组合,暴力破解难度提升两个数量级。银行、电信等关键行业普遍采用6位验证码,既能保证用户记忆输入效率,又能满足金融级安全需求。
二、6位验证码的安全机制分析
营业厅验证码系统的安全性依赖于多重技术保障:
- 动态生成算法:基于时间戳和随机种子生成非连续验证码
- 时效性控制:设置120-300秒有效期限阻断重放攻击
- 传输加密:采用TLS加密通道防止中间人劫持
- 频率限制:同一号码24小时内最多触发10次验证请求
位数 | 组合数 | 暴力破解时间 |
---|---|---|
4位 | 10,000 | 约3分钟 |
6位 | 1,000,000 | 约5小时 |
三、营业厅验证码的核心设计原则
基于行业最佳实践,6位验证码设计需遵循以下原则:
- 随机性优先:采用密码学安全随机数生成器(CSPRNG)生成验证码
- 输入优化:支持系统自动填充与手动输入双模式
- 异常检测:实时监控IP地址、设备指纹等风险特征
- 失效策略:错误尝试超过3次立即作废验证码
四、应用场景优化与用户体验平衡
在营业厅业务场景中,验证码系统需根据业务风险等级动态调整:
- 低风险操作(如查询余额)采用单一短信验证
- 高风险操作(如SIM卡补办)叠加生物特征验证
- 特殊场景(无网络环境)提供语音验证码备选方案
验证码界面设计需符合Fitts定律,输入框间距保持12-16pt视觉舒适区,错误提示采用即时反馈机制。
6位验证码作为当前营业厅主流验证方案,其安全性源自严谨的算法设计和多维防护机制。未来发展方向将聚焦动态风险评估与无感知验证技术的融合,在保障安全性的同时减少用户交互成本。行业需持续关注新型攻击手段,定期更新验证码生成规则和传输协议。
内容仅供参考,具体资费以办理页面为准。其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
本文由神卡网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://www.xnnu.com/299635.html